Loyal fan Joe’s crazy day out!

-

EXETER City fan Joe McCrea has been named the Sky Bet League Two Fan of the Month for March – but it could all have gone horribly wrong.

A missed alarm at 6am meant he failed to catch the supporters’ coach to Carlisle and put his ever-present season in jeopardy.

However, the student got a taxi to Exeter train station for 7.30am and paid £130 for a one-way ticket to Carlisle to ensure he was there to see the 3-1 victory.

He said: “I had to find a way of getting there and it turned into a day I will remember for the rest of my life.” Grecians boss Paul Tisdale,

pictured with Joe, said: “I’m glad we were able to reward his dedication with a terrific win!”

Fulham fan Pete Wilkes took the Championsh­ip accolade and Bristol City supporter Jerry Tocknell the League One prize.
